How to remove a measure? You'll see a variety of options to control which measures should be numbered automatically (eg, every measure, every 5 measures, first measure of every system, etc). Or click one measure number, increase its size and make any other adjustments you want in the Inspector, then hit the "Set as style" ("S" icon) button next to the corresponding control. Note there is also a "Pitch Spell" command in the Notes menu, but works globally - no way to restrict it just a single passage. To adjust just a single system, use either line breaks (http://musescore.org/en/handbook/break-or-spacer) or else play with the stretch setting for the measures involved (Layout->Add More/Less Stretch). To alter measure numbers right click on the measure where you want the change to occur, and select "measure properties." From there a window will appear; under other you will see "add to measure no.
